1. Vision
This is where it all begins. You need clarity on what you want your practice to look and feel like. What kind of patient experience do you want to create? What innovations do you want to bring to your community? This step lays the foundation for every decision that follows.
2. Financing
Let’s be honest—no financing, no practice. But don’t worry. We’ve helped thousands of dentists secure loans with minimal stress. Banks love to lend to dentists, especially when you have the right plan.

3. Demographics
One of the most overlooked steps. Who is your ideal patient? Where do they live? You’ll be working with these patients for years to come, so it’s worth taking the time—usually one to two months—to really define this.
4. Site Selection
Location matters more than you think. It affects your patient flow, your construction costs, and your marketing strategy. We follow the 1-to-2,000 rule: one dentist for every 2,000 residents. Choosing the right site often takes one to three months of research and scouting.
5. Design & Floorplan
Now it’s time to bring your vision to life. The layout and floorplan of your practice should be both beautiful and functional. Expect this to take one to two months. We’ll help you balance your wishlist with what’s realistic and budget-conscious.
6. Equipment Selection
What you choose—and what you skip—can make or break your budget. We run cost analyses to ensure you get exactly what you need and nothing you don’t. This step usually takes one to two months.
7. Construction Bidding
This step is fast if you know what you’re doing. Ideally, it should be wrapped up in about a month.
8. Permits
Permits are the gatekeepers of progress. From zoning to HIPAA to occupancy, there’s a lot to cover. Depending on your location, this step can take anywhere from one to five months.
9. Marketing & Hiring Begins
This is the phase where you start building your dream team and creating your buzz. Over the next three to five months, you’ll begin hiring staff and launching your marketing campaigns. We’ll guide you through strategies that align with your location, budget, and brand voice.
10. Construction Begins
It’s go time. The build-out begins and typically lasts three to five months. Our team will help you manage contractors, timelines, and costs so you can focus on staying sane (and excited).
11. Equipment Installation
Once the walls are up, the equipment goes in. This phase overlaps a bit with construction and usually takes three to five months.
12. Dress Rehearsal
Think of this as your soft opening. We’ll walk you through a detailed checklist and practice every part of the patient experience. This ensures that by the time your doors open, you’re confident and ready.
13. Grand Opening
You made it! After about 12 months of focused work, you’re ready to welcome your first patients. Take a deep breath, look around, and be proud. You built this from the ground up.
